In order to support the Royal Norwegian Navy in specifying and developing a new generation of fast patrol boats (FPBs), FFI has cooperated with the Navy in several study and analysis activities. Following these, a testbed for human-computer interfaces (HCIs) in the operations room was developed. In the same period, FFI participated in a research program aimed at the next generation of bridge systems for high-speed marine craft. The work included developing a laboratory prototype of an integrated bridge.
